#include "dirichlet.h"
|
|
|
|
static void
|
|
dirichlet_chi_vec_evenpart(ulong *v, const dirichlet_group_t G, const dirichlet_char_t chi, ulong order, slong nv)
|
|
{
|
|
ulong mult = G->expo / order;
|
|
if (G->neven >= 1 && chi->log[0])
|
|
{
|
|
ulong x, c3 = G->PHI[0] / mult;
|
|
for (x = 3; x < nv; x += 4)
|
|
v[x] = c3;
|
|
}
|
|
if (G->neven == 2 && chi->log[1])
|
|
{
|
|
ulong x, g, vx, xp, c4;
|
|
nmod_t pe, o;
|
|
nmod_init(&o, order);
|
|
|
|
pe = G->P[1].pe;
|
|
g = G->P[1].g;
|
|
|
|
vx = c4 = (chi->log[1] * G->PHI[1]) / mult;
|
|
for (x = g; x > 1;)
|
|
{
|
|
|
|
for (xp = x; xp < nv; xp += pe.n)
|
|
v[xp] = nmod_add(v[xp], vx, o);
|
|
|
|
for (xp = pe.n - x; xp < nv; xp += pe.n)
|
|
v[xp] = nmod_add(v[xp], vx, o);
|
|
|
|
x = nmod_mul(x, g, pe);
|
|
vx = nmod_add(vx, c4, o);
|
|
}
|
|
}
|
|
}
|
|
|
|
/* loop over primary components */
|
|
void
|
|
dirichlet_chi_vec_primeloop_order(ulong *v, const dirichlet_group_t G, const dirichlet_char_t chi, ulong order, slong nv)
|
|
{
|
|
slong k, l;
|
|
ulong mult = G->expo / order;
|
|
nmod_t o;
|
|
nmod_init(&o, order);
|
|
|
|
for (k = 0; k < nv; k++)
|
|
v[k] = 0;
|
|
|
|
if (G->neven)
|
|
dirichlet_chi_vec_evenpart(v, G, chi, order, nv);
|
|
|
|
for (l = G->neven; l < G->num; l++)
|
|
{
|
|
dirichlet_prime_group_struct P = G->P[l];
|
|
|
|
/* FIXME: there may be some precomputed dlog in P if needed */
|
|
if (P.dlog == NULL)
|
|
dlog_vec_add(v, nv, P.g, (chi->log[l] * G->PHI[l]) / mult, P.pe, P.phi.n, o);
|
|
else
|
|
dlog_vec_add_precomp(v, nv, P.dlog, P.g, (chi->log[l] * G->PHI[l]) / mult, P.pe, P.phi.n, o);
|
|
|
|
}
|
|
dirichlet_vec_set_null(v, G, nv);
|
|
}
|
|
|
|
void
|
|
dirichlet_chi_vec_primeloop(ulong *v, const dirichlet_group_t G, const dirichlet_char_t chi, slong nv)
|
|
{
|
|
dirichlet_chi_vec_primeloop_order(v, G, chi, G->expo, nv);
|
|
}
